It looks like ovdd-supply is using the 2.9V regulator (savdd_cam1) instead of the 1.8V regulator (siovdd_cam1) defined earlier in the overlay. Supplying 2.9V to the 1.8V digital I/O domain of the IMX415 sensor might exceed its voltage rating and potentially cause hardware damage. Should this property be updated to reference siovdd_cam1? --=20 Sashiko AI review =C2=B7 https://sashiko.dev/#/patchset/20260508-rk3588-vic= ap-v4-0-6a6cd6f7c90b@collabora.com?part=3D7
